    Super Enchi

    I recently realized that they exist (yes I'm slow), and thought about the potential it could have in a collection. I mean anything you breed it to would just be enchi galore, and who doesn't love enchi morphs? However I have never seen one for sale, and it seems rarely do people hatch one out. Just find it a bit odd there aren't more out there with all the enchi love being spread about and all. If you have hatched one, or have pictures that it would be cool to have some input on the topic

    people produce them and sometimes they are for sale.


    but they are quite high price and very high demand, precisely because they are so awesome for breeding, and because prices for anything with enchi or even single-gene ench are still reasonably high and they sell well.

    there got to be a lot of them around, because so many combos that contain super enchi have already been done. like firefly super enchi, or super pastel super enchi, or lemonblast super enchi.

    i guess, except for a few high-end breeders, people that produce a super enchi will most likely keep it.
